In the DreamLeague Season 29 China Closed Qualifier's double-elimination lower bracket round 1, Mideng Dreamer meets Vici Gaming in a do-or-die BO3 after both upper quarterfinal losses on April 12. Mideng Dreamer (world #47, 71% win rate over last seven series) fell 1-2 to Roar Gaming despite upsetting Cloud Dawning recently, buoyed by carry lou and mid 7e's form on patch 7.41b. Veteran Vici Gaming (58% win rate last three months) exited abruptly via forfeit to The goal of all life is death, highlighting shaky momentum. No recent head-to-head; trader consensus weighs Mideng's hot streak against VG's experience for the sole main event qualification spot.
